c语言编程笔录

首页 >   > 笔记大全

笔记大全

C语言字符串输出函数puts+的作用有哪些

更新时间:2023-07-01

介绍

在C语言中,字符串是由一系列字符组成的字符数组。字符串输出是程序中常见的操作之一,而C语言提供了多种用于输出字符串的函数。其中之一是puts函数,它是一种输出字符串的标准库函数。

代码用途

puts函数用于将一个字符串输出到标准输出设备(通常是显示器)。它的基本原型如下:

#include 

int puts(const char* str);

这里的str参数是一个指向以null字符结尾的字符串的指针,即C语言中的字符串。

puts函数的主要作用是将传入的字符串逐字符输出到标准输出,直到遇到字符串的结尾(null字符)。

代码规范

在使用puts函数时,需要注意以下几点:

  1. 确保传入puts函数的字符串以null字符结尾。
  2. puts函数会自动在输出的字符串末尾添加换行符,因此不需要手动添加。
  3. puts函数返回一个非负整数,如果输出成功则返回非负值,否则返回EOF。

总结

通过使用C语言中的puts函数,开发人员可以方便地将字符串输出到标准输出设备。这个函数简单易用,但需要注意传入的字符串必须以null字符结尾,并且函数会自动在输出的字符串末尾添加换行符。